About the Journal

Interamerican Journal of Health Sciences is the peer-reviewed scientific journal edited by the School of Medicine and Health Sciences of the Universidad Abierta Interamericana. The main objective of IJHS is to provide Health Professionals with comprehensive valued information and high-quality research related to biomedical sciences, clinical practice, and medical education. IJHS is published in different volumes a year, and the online edition is open access.

IJHS's mission is to produce, propagate, and preserve biomedical knowledge by the highest standards to improve patients outcomes and enhance medical education.

This journal prints original and unpublished contributions that meet the journal's current editorial standards.

The collaboration of the editors, authors and reviewers of this journal and the ethics guide for editorial processes is governed by the Principles of transparency and good practice in academic publications of the Committee on Publication Ethics (COPE), EQUATOR Network (Enhancing the QUAlity and Transparency Of health Research), World Association of Medical Editors , Open Access Scholarly Publishers AssociationICMJE (International Committee of Medical Journal Editors) and DOAJ (Directory of Open Access Journals)
